
Escalating violence in southern Lebanon has led to the deaths of three journalists and ten soldiers, Lebanese officials reported. The Ministry of Health confirmed that three journalists were killed and three others injured in an attack on their accommodation in Hasbaya.
Lebanese Minister of Information, Ziad Makary, condemned the attack on his X account, calling it a “premeditated assassination.” He stated, “The Israeli enemy waited for the journalists to rest at night, betraying them in their sleep. For months, they have covered the field, exposing crimes. This was a deliberate assassination, with 18 journalists from seven media organizations present at the scene. This is a war crime.”
Minister Makary paid tribute to the fallen journalists Ghassan Najjar, Muhammad Reda, and Wissam Qassem, extending condolences to their families and the media outlets Al-Mayadeen and Al-Manar TV.
Meanwhile, the Israeli Defense Forces (IDF) confirmed the deaths of ten soldiers involved in combat in Lebanon, clarifying that these fatalities were not recent but had been officially confirmed only after notifying the soldiers’ families.
